October 4, 1984 - In a speech at the UN General Assembly in October 1984, Sankara denounced Israel’s actions in Palestine as “an arrogant disregard for the international community” and expressed his solidarity with Palestinian fighters.
The Pan-African revolutionary repeatedly supported the Palestinian cause, showing full solidarity and respect, describing Palestinians as “courageous, determined, stoic, and tireless” in their effort to “remind every human conscience of the moral necessity and obligation to respect the rights of a people.”
Sankara also frequently connected the struggles of oppressed peoples in his political speeches. In 1986, he stated, “We condemn and fight against apartheid in South Africa, just as we condemn Zionism in Palestine.” [video]
